Technical Field

The invention relates to the technical field of intelligent lubrication, in particular to an anti-pollution intelligent lubricating device and a using method thereof.

Background

The lubricating grease is a thick grease-like semisolid which is used for a mechanical friction part to play a role in lubrication and sealing, is also used for a metal surface to play a role in filling gaps and preventing rust, and is mainly prepared from mineral oil (or synthetic lubricating oil) and a thickening agent.

The existing lubricating device is generally composed of parts such as an oil drum, an electric oil pump, an oil way distributor, an oil pipe and the like, and is directly placed beside required equipment without any dustproof measure, dust on industrial fields such as cement grinding, ore crushing workshops and the like is very serious, pollutants such as dust and the like are easy to enter the oil drum and the lubricating device, the pollution and the failure of lubricating grease are particularly easy to cause, once the pollutants such as the dust and the like enter the lubricating part of the equipment through the lubricating device, the service life of parts needing to be lubricated such as bearings and the like is influenced, the parts needing to be lubricated are damaged in serious conditions, the equipment is stopped, and the maintenance cost of the equipment.

Detailed Description

The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.

Referring to fig. 1, the present invention provides a technical solution: the utility model provides an anti-pollution intelligent lubricating arrangement, including device body 13, device body 13 comprises the totally enclosed cabinet body 11 and reprint 12, the right side at device body 13 positive surface top is provided with integrated form electrical system 6, the top of device body 13 is provided with photoelectric alarm 1, the positive surface of device body 13 is provided with pneumatic butter pump 4, pneumatic butter pump 4 is the pneumatic butter pump of big compression ratio industrial grade, the output of pneumatic butter pump 4 is provided with oil drum 5, be furnished with special leakproofness bung and pressure oil pan in the oil drum 5, the bottom of oil drum 5 is provided with oil drum dolly 10, the income gas end of pneumatic butter pump 4 is provided with pneumatic trigeminy piece 3, the intercommunication has gas pressure sensor 2 on the pneumatic trigeminy piece 3, the output of pneumatic butter pump 4 has grease filter 7 through the pipe intercommunication, be provided with grease choke valve 8 and grease pressure sensor 9 on the grease filter 7 respectively.

The use method of the anti-pollution intelligent lubricating device comprises the anti-pollution intelligent lubricating device and specifically comprises the following operations:

s1, injecting air into the pneumatic triple piece 3 through an air receiving source, and simultaneously monitoring the air pressure condition in real time through the air pressure sensor 2;

s2, air enters a pneumatic grease pump 4 through a pneumatic triple 3 (current working parameters are monitored through a gas pressure sensor 2 and a grease pressure sensor 9, the flow speed of lubricating grease is regulated by controlling a grease throttling valve 8 through an integrated electric control system 6, and a user is timely prompted when the parameters exceed a safety range through a photoelectric alarm 1);

s3, providing air pressure to drive the pneumatic grease pump 4, sending the grease in the oil drum 5 to the parts needing lubrication such as bearings and oil seals at regular time and fixed quantity, and filtering the grease under the action of the grease filter 7.

To sum up, the anti-pollution intelligent lubricating device and the use method thereof adopt the protective design of the fully sealed cabinet body 11, integrate the oil drum 5, the pneumatic grease pump 4, the integrated electric control system 6 and other components in the fully sealed cabinet body 11, use the air pressure as the power, send the lubricating grease to the parts needing to be lubricated such as the bearing, the oil seal and the like in a timed and quantitative way through the pneumatic grease pump 4, can effectively prevent the pollutants such as dust and the like from entering the oil drum 5, all the parts of the lubricating system and the electric components, prevent the pollution and the failure of the lubricating grease, prolong the service lives of the parts needing to be lubricated, all the parts of the lubricating system and the electric components, ensure the long-period trouble-free normal operation of the equipment, have convenient operation, can be connected into a host system to realize linkage control and also can be independently controlled, can adjust the lubricating period according to the actual working, when the faults of blockage, oil shortage, gas shortage and the like of the distributor or the pipeline are automatically alarmed and the solution is displayed, the fault finding is timely, convenient and quick to solve.
